Abstract
Sepiolite was used as a filler in epoxidized natural rubber (ENR) composites. The sepiolite filled ENR composites with and without silane coupling agent were carried out on laboratory sized two roll mill and cured by using semi-efficient sulphur vulcanization (semi-EV) system. The amount of sepiolite loading with and without silane coupling agent was fixed at 0.0 phr, 1.0 phr, 2.5 phr, 5.0 phr, 7.5 phr and 10.0 phr respectively. The studies involve in this research were curing characteristics, tear behaviour, rubber-filler interaction and morphological properties. The curing characteristics ENR composite was enhanced by addition of sepiolite with and without silane coupling agent. It show the reduction of optimum cure time and scorch time of sepiolite filled ENR composites with and without silane coupling agent once filler was added. However, the maximum torque and torque difference were increased with the increasing of sepiolite loading with and without silane coupling agent. Besides that, the presence of silane coupling agent also improve the curing characteristics of sepiolite filled ENR composites by improvement of filler dispersion and crosslinking between rubber matrix and sepiolite. The tear behaviour of ENR composite also improved when sepiolite with and without silane coupling agent was added. The tear strength of sepiolite filled ENR composites with and without silane coupling was found to increase until it reached certain amount of sepiolite loading. This due to better dispersion at different loading of untreated and treated sepiolite which shown in the SEM micrograph. In addition, swelling test also shows that rubber-filler interaction was stronger when untreated and treated sepiolite was added.
